Output ae66edccb6cc75158f4093f52a56c8fc51c030d887ea1f6af28302dfc9dce5a6:0

value
348462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ee1212bd6880fc0836199a78a4b1b51960538e OP_EQUAL
address
32WEXWjty7Hg3W55rssXeJnvoWCz8xEjsQ
transaction
ae66edccb6cc75158f4093f52a56c8fc51c030d887ea1f6af28302dfc9dce5a6
spent
true